Building a Tent Platform: A Guide to Creating a Sturdy and Comfortable Base for Your Camping Adventures

Camping is a great way to escape the hustle and bustle of everyday life and connect with nature. However, sleeping on the ground can be uncomfortable and even dangerous if the ground is uneven or rocky. That’s where a tent platform comes in. A tent platform is a raised surface that provides a sturdy and comfortable base for your tent. In this guide, we’ll show you how to build a tent platform that will make your camping adventures more enjoyable.

Step 1: Choose a Location

The first step in building a tent platform is to choose a location. Look for a flat, level area that is free of rocks, roots, and other debris. Make sure the area is large enough to accommodate your tent and any other gear you plan to bring. It’s also important to consider the surrounding environment. Choose a location that is protected from the wind and rain, and that offers a good view of the surrounding scenery.

Step 2: Gather Materials

Once you’ve chosen a location, it’s time to gather materials. You’ll need pressure-treated lumber, galvanized screws, a circular saw, a drill, a level, and a measuring tape. You may also want to consider adding a layer of gravel or sand to the area to improve drainage and prevent moisture buildup.

Step 3: Build the Frame

The next step is to build the frame. Start by measuring the dimensions of your tent and adding a few inches on each side for extra space. Cut four pieces of pressure-treated lumber to these dimensions and screw them together to form a square or rectangle. Use a level to ensure that the frame is level and square.

Step 4: Add Support Beams

Once the frame is complete, it’s time to add support beams. Cut two pieces of pressure-treated lumber to the length of the frame and screw them to the underside of the frame, perpendicular to the frame boards. These support beams will help distribute the weight of the tent and prevent the platform from sagging.

Step 5: Install Decking

The final step is to install the decking. Cut pressure-treated lumber to fit the dimensions of the frame and screw them to the top of the frame boards. Be sure to leave a small gap between each board to allow for drainage. You may also want to consider adding a non-slip surface to the decking to prevent slips and falls.

FAQ

1. What materials do I need to build a tent platform?
– To build a tent platform, you will need pressure-treated lumber, galvanized screws, a circular saw, a drill, a level, and a measuring tape.

2. How high should my tent platform be?
– The height of your tent platform will depend on the terrain and the size of your tent. Generally, a height of 12-18 inches is recommended to keep the platform level and prevent water from pooling underneath.

3. Can I build a tent platform on uneven ground?
– Yes, you can build a tent platform on uneven ground by using adjustable post bases or shims to level the platform. It’s important to ensure that the platform is stable and secure before setting up your tent.
